What Are OTA Updates, Really?
In the simplest terms, an OTA update is a wireless delivery of new software or firmware to your vehicle. Manufacturers can send these updates to fix bugs, patch security vulnerabilities, add new features, or even—and this is the cool part—improve things like battery management in an EV or the calibration of your driver-assist systems.
Think of it as a digital tune-up. Instead of a mechanic adjusting a carburetor, a software engineer’s code tweaks how your car thinks. It’s a fundamental shift from the static machine you bought to a platform that can evolve.
The Two Main Flavors of Car Updates
Not all OTAs are created equal. Honestly, it’s good to know the difference:
- S-OTA (Software Over-the-Air): This is for the infotainment system. Updates to maps, your music apps, the voice assistant interface. It’s the most common type right now and, you know, enhances your daily experience.
- F-OTA (Firmware Over-the-Air): This is the big one. This updates the firmware that controls critical vehicle functions—the powertrain, brakes, battery, and advanced driver-assistance systems (ADAS). It’s a deeper, more significant change that can alter how the car drives.

Essential Maintenance Tips for OTA Health
Maintaining your OTA system isn’t about getting under the hood with a wrench. It’s about digital hygiene and good habits.
- Connectivity is King: Your car needs a strong, stable Wi-Fi connection, usually your home network. Updates are large files; a weak signal can corrupt the download. Park within good range of your router when an update is pending.
- Battery Matters. A Lot: The update process can take 20 minutes to over an hour. Manufacturers always advise ensuring the vehicle is parked, not in use, and has a sufficiently charged battery. For gas cars, a full tank isn’t the concern—it’s the 12-volt battery. For EVs, the high-voltage battery needs ample charge (often 40%+). A failed update due to a dead battery can brick systems, requiring a tow to the dealer. That’s a pain point you want to avoid.
- Read the Notifications: Don’t just swipe away the alert on your dashboard or companion app. It will tell you the estimated time, if you need to be out of the vehicle, and any other prerequisites. This is not a “remind me later” thing.
- Keep Your Profile Updated: Ensure your contact info and preferences are current in the manufacturer’s app. This is how they notify you about recalls or urgent updates.
A Quick Checklist Before You Hit “Install”
| 1. Connection | Parked with strong Wi-Fi signal. |
| 2. Battery | 12V battery healthy (gas/hybrid) or main battery >40% (EV). |
| 3. Ignition | Vehicle is in “Park” and the ignition is in the correct mode (often “On” but engine off). |
| 4. Schedule | Choose a time when you won’t need the car for several hours. |
| 5. Patience | Do not interrupt the process. Lights may flash, fans may run. This is normal. |
Security and Privacy: The Invisible Maintenance
This part feels abstract, but it’s vital. Your connected car is a node on the internet. OTA systems are a major target for bad actors. The manufacturer’s job is to build robust digital walls. Your job is to not leave the gate open.
How? First, install updates promptly. Those security patches are often in response to newly discovered vulnerabilities. Delaying is like knowing your front door lock is broken but waiting to fix it.
Second, be mindful of what you connect. That cheap, off-brand dongle you plugged into the OBD-II port? It could be a backdoor. Stick to manufacturer-recommended accessories and be cautious with third-party apps that request deep vehicle access.
Troubleshooting Common OTA Update Issues
Sometimes things go sideways. If an update fails or your car hasn’t received one in a long while, here’s a human way to troubleshoot:
- Reset the Connectivity: Turn off the car’s Wi-Fi hotspot (if equipped), forget your home network, and re-add it. It’s the classic “turn it off and on again” for your car’s modem.
- Check for Manual Triggers: Many infotainment systems have a “Check for Updates” button buried in the settings menu. Give it a press.
- Consult the Community: Owner forums and subreddits for your specific model are goldmines. Chances are, someone else has hit the same snag and found a fix.
- The Nuclear Option: A full infotainment system reset (factory reset) can clear software gremlins blocking updates. Just know you’ll lose saved settings and paired phones.
